Cetuximab with FOLFIRI: continuous or intermittent for first-line metastatic colorectal cancer

Colorectal Cancer Metastatic

Part of Cancer, Digestive system clinical trials.

This trial tests whether giving a targeted drug (cetuximab) with chemotherapy continuously or on breaks works better as a first treatment for people with a specific type of colorectal cancer that has spread (RAS/BRAF wild-type). The goal is to find a way to maintain control of the cancer with fewer side effects.

Phase
Phase 3
Enrollment
267 people
Ages
18 years and older
Study type
Interventional

Who can take part

  • You must have colorectal cancer that has spread to other parts of the body (stage IV) and cannot be removed with surgery.
  • Your tumor must have no mutations in the RAS or BRAF genes (called 'wild-type'). This will be confirmed by a blood test.
  • You cannot have had chemotherapy for advanced colorectal cancer, except for maybe 2 cycles of FOLFIRI before joining.
  • You need to be in generally good health (able to do normal activities, with good kidney, liver, and blood counts).
  • You must be 18 or older and willing to use effective birth control during and for a while after treatment.
  • You need to have a tumor sample available for testing and agree to genetic testing on your blood and tumor.
